Welcome to the Pellwick platform team. Every service instance exposes a /healthz endpoint that the Varnholt load balancer polls every ten seconds; three consecutive failures remove the instance from rotation. Responses must return within 500ms and include the build hash so we can trace drift. To query the health aggregator directly during onboarding, authenticate with the key below.

API key for yahig-tadup: kto7_ubizbYm

Subject: Partner SFTP drop — new owner

Hi,

As you review the pending changes to the Harborline ingest scripts, note that ownership of the partner SFTP drop is changing at the end of the month. This includes key rotation, the nightly pull job, and the quarantine folder for malformed files. Review comments on the retry logic should still go through the normal PR flow, but questions about drop-folder conventions or partner onboarding now go to the new owner. The incoming owner is listed below.

signatory, tagaf-bahaf: Praael Fenmir Rusok

Management Meeting Minutes — Possible Acquisition of Brellux Systems

Present: senior management. Apologies: two regional leads.

Diligence on Brellux Systems is 70% complete. Valuation range agreed internally. Integration owner: Dana Korvath. Sales leads to avoid client-facing comment until announcement. Next steps: final legal review, term sheet by month end. Decision meeting scheduled in Aldwyn. The confidential note on strategic intent follows below.

board note of bawep-tajef: Queniusek Systems plans to raise the Quenvan list price by 53.1 percent in March. The pricing group signed off on a budget of $176.4 million for Project Drueth. The renewal with Casionix Partners closes at $142.5 million a year, 8.3 percent below the last contract. Project Fraax slips by six weeks because of the tooling delay.

/*
 * Threshold used by the Wrenlock typo-squatting scanner when comparing a
 * candidate package name against our internal registry. Names within this
 * edit distance of a protected package are quarantined for manual review
 * rather than blocked outright — false positives are common with short
 * names, so do not lower this without checking the Havermill test corpus.
 * If you change it, rerun the full corpus and record results. The scanner
 * build token for the last validated run appears below.
 */

build token for kagaf-hahof: htk14_9d3d4d26d7d8de